The Sea Ranch Chapel

For a printable copy click here

OPEN:

Daily (Open & closing hours depend on the season)

PRIMARY USE:

Individual & group prayer and meditation of nonsectarian nature.

PRIVATE USES:

Memorial services, weddings, commitments, baptisms etc.

RESERVATIONS:

Verbal requests for a reservation date are accepted on a temporary basis only to alleviate conflicts in facility use scheduling. Private use reservations, therefore, are considered binding only upon receipt of a rental fee, a cleaning/security deposit and a sponsor which requires the signature of an Association member.

USER FEES:

Private functions - $350.00 rental, $40.00 Facilities Monitor fee plus $100.00 cleaning & security deposit (refundable) all of which must be paid in advance.

CAPACITY:

Use of Chapel site (inside as well as outside) is limited to 20 PEOPLE MAXIMUM

CANCELLATION: In case of a cancellation, a written ten-day notice before the event must be received to qualify for a refund. EXCEPTION: For reservations made more that 30 days in advance, 30 days written notice is required. The Association will deduct $20.00 from the fee to cover processing of any cancellation.
RESTRICTIONS:
  • NO RICE, BIRDSEED, CONFETTI  or any other substance may cast about on the Chapel site. Please...no signs, balloons, streamers etc. to be placed on Highway 1, at the entrance or on site.
  • NO food or beverages permitted on the Chapel Site.
  • NO smoking, candles or open flame ont he Chapel Site.
  • NO receptions or formal gatherings allowed on the Chapel site.
  • Use of Chapel site, (inside and outside) is limited to 20 people Maximum.
  • Facility must be thoroughly cleaned by user after use.
  • If used agter hours (5:00 PM or later) arrangements must be made with permission of the Community Manger.
PARKING & RESTROOMS Parking is limited to the 14 designated parking spaces only

No RVs allowed on the Chapel site.

There are no toilet facilities on the Chapel site.

NOTICE: FAILURE TO COMPLY WITH ANY OF THESE RESTRICTIONS MAY RESULT IN THE FORFEITURE OF THE CLEANING AND SECURITY DEPOSIT!

HOW TO MAKE A RESERVATION:

Please contact Paula Lim, Chapel Coordinator, at the Sea Ranch Association Office 707-785-2444 plim@tsra.org Tuesday – Saturday, 9 a.m. – 2 p.m. at least 10 business days prior to your event to request date and time availability.  The Coordinator or the Front Desk receptionist will help set up a temporary reservation in order to prepare necessary agreement and policy forms which the user must sign and return with fees. They will explain the procedure and answer any questions you may have before paperwork is prepared and mailed. The policy forms will include restrictions, cancellation and parking information.
